Actually its a reality, IrishSkyline was willing to do it for $150, I quote..

"I can tell you normal labor rates average about $75/hr around the Bay, and typical 2 hour install for just springs. So expect to pay $150. I would worry about quality of install if less than this. Thanks.
Jeff"

there isnt a lot of shops that will do it for 150 in the bay area... when i asked the dealer just for ****s and giggles they wanted 300-400. and average for most other shops i talked to in the bay area was around 200-275
